    IMPORTANT SCHOLARSHIP INFORMATION 
     
    This application contains information regarding the Northern Texas PGA Foundation Scholarship Program.
    • Applications must be electronically submitted to the Northern Texas PGA by Friday, February 6th, 2026, at 11:59 p.m. CST
    • Applicants MUST be a 2025 and/or 2026 member of the NTPGA Junior Tour.
    • Applicants MUST have at least a cumulative GPA of 3.0 on a 4.0 scale.
    • Achievement in the Junior Tour tournament program is not part of the selection criteria. 
    • All applicants MUST be a high school senior graduating in 2026 in order to be eligible.
    Applicants must have completed (or plan to complete) high school prior to August 1, 2026, and have enrolled (or plan to enroll) in an accredited college or university in the fall of 2026. 
     
    Along with each application, the applicant must submit the following information: 
    • Financial information (household income, Student Aid Report)
    • A copy of his/her most recent transcript (can be unofficial) 
    • A copy of his/her ACT/SAT test scores*
    • Responses to short answers (see below) 
    *If you have elected to not take the ACT or SAT, you are still eligible to submit an application. 
     
    Semi-finalists will be asked to take part in a one-way video interview. All semi-finalists will be determined by Monday, February 23, 2026 (subject to change). Not all applicants will be selected as a semi-finalist.
     
    Upon review of all videos, finalists will be determined by Friday, March 20, 2026 (subject to change). Second round interviews are to be completed by Monday, April 6, 2026 (subject to change).
     
    Scholarship winners will be notified by Monday, May 11, 2026 (subject to change).

  • ABOUT THE NTPGA FOUNDATION SCHOLARSHIP PROGRAM
     
    PURPOSE:
    The purpose of the NTPGA Foundation Scholarship Program is to encourage and promote the attainment of higher education goals for current and past NTPGA Junior Tour members.

    SCHOLARSHIPS:
    The NTPGA Foundation Scholarship Program is designed to award multiple one-year college scholarships for freshman in college. Please visit www.ntpgajuniorgolf.com, and click on the "College Scholarship" tab to learn more about our 2025 scholarship winners.

    SELECTION OF FINALISTS:
    Scholarship semi-finalists and finalists will be selected based on the following criteria:
    > Academic Performance - includes GPA and/or ACT/SAT test scores
    > Extracurricular Activities
    > Short Answers

    Financial need will serve as a selection criteria for many, but not all scholarships. Achievement in the Junior Tour tournament program is not part of the selection criteria.

    INTERVIEWS:
    Finalists will be asked to take part in a one-way video interview. 

    ANNOUNCEMENT OF RECIPIENTS:
    Scholarship recipients will be announced in May upon the completion of interviews.

  • RELATIONSHIP TO PGA PROFESSIONAL: 
    Children, grandchildren, step-children or adopted children of an NTPGA Professional (PGA Member) in good standing (living or deceased) are eligible for four (4) additional scholarships. Please note that only one (1) scholarship in total may be awarded per applicant.
